I had an interesting conversation today on the benefits of e-mail and snail mail. Basically a lively discussion over which was better and surprisingly the end result was that snail mail is better for marketing than e-mail.
While e-mail is cheaper and quicker it has major drawbacks pointed out by all of us involved in the discussion. It's easy to send and e-mail to multiple recipients but it's also just as easy for those recipients to hit the delete button without ever opening your message. As a matter of fact is seemed that was the standard for e-mail we did not request. Also there is the problem of e-mail getting misdirecting into a junk folder. Normally we seemed to only react positively to email from friends or business contacts we already knew.
However snail mail has far more benefits than drawbacks. The main drawback to snail mail was the cost. even a direct mailing postcard gets seen on the way to the trashbin. However cards announcements etc almost always get read. It doesn't matter if it is promotional or not, it gets opened if it looks like a card even if we didn't know the sender! The other thing that was brought up was "Hidden card syndrome". You put a card on your desk and it gets mixed in with paperwork or other mail and gets hidden for a while. One day while going through the stuff on your desk the card you got a couple of months ago suddenly pops up to remind you of a business contact you had forgotten about...
